Dr. Remi Bernard is a Departmental Visitor in the Nuclear Physics & Accelerator Applications department at the Australian National University (ANU), working with the Subatomic physics research group. His research focuses on theoretical nuclear physics, particularly in the areas of nuclear fission theory and computational modeling of nuclear processes.
Dr. Bernard's research interests include:
- Nuclear fission theory and dynamics
- Quantum shell effects in heavy element fission
- Potential energy surfaces and their numerical treatment
- Nucleon-nucleus scattering
- Computational methods for nuclear physics
- Heavy element synthesis and stability
His recent publications demonstrate a strong focus on advancing our understanding of nuclear fission processes, particularly in heavy and superheavy elements. Dr. Bernard has contributed to the development of computational tools like the SIDES code for nucleon-nucleus scattering and has conducted systematic studies of mass-asymmetric fission across a range of heavy nuclei. His work bridges theoretical nuclear physics with computational approaches to solve complex problems in nuclear structure and reactions, with publications spanning from 2020 to 2023 showing active research contributions.
Dr. Bernard actively collaborates with researchers at ANU and internationally, as evidenced by his co-authorship on multiple publications with scientists from various institutions. His work connects fundamental nuclear theory with practical applications in nuclear energy and heavy element research.
